admin管理员组

文章数量:1531374

2023年12月28日发(作者:)

lua ssl certificate verify error

在开发和操作网络应用程序时,我们通常需要确保加密和安全性,以便在最终用户访问我们的应用程序时保持其机密性和完整性。在这种情况下,SSL证书验证是至关重要的。然而,出现了一个问题,即“Lua SSL证书验证错误”。

首先,让我们来看看什么是SSL证书验证错误。SSL证书验证在建立安全连接时使用,并验证该连接是否与预期的服务器进行通信。如果SSL证书验证失败,则可能说明连接受到中间人攻击的威胁。SSL证书验证错误是指验证过程中出现错误的情况。这可能是由于证书过期、证书颁发机构无效、证书与主机名不匹配等原因引起的。

接下来,我们将分步骤讨论如何解决Lua SSL证书验证错误。

第一步是检查证书的过期日期。如果SSL证书已过期,则您需要删除旧证书并重新安装新证书以解决问题。如果证书是有效的,则可能与证书颁发机构或证书和主机名之间存在问题。

第二步是确保证书颁发机构有效。如果证书颁发机构不受信任或已失效,则可能会出现SSL验证错误。在这种情况下,您需要查找新的颁发机构或更新证书。一种简单的方法是使用一些已知的颁发机构,例如COMODO,Let's Encrypt等。

第三步是确保证书与主机名(域名)匹配。如果证书与主机名不匹配,则将导致SSL验证错误。在这种情况下,您可以使用匹配的SSL证书。检查证书是否与主机名匹配的另一种方法是通过通配符使用相同的证书。

第四步是确保SSL证书正确安装。在大多数情况下,SSL验证错误可能是由于不正确的安装证书引起的。请确保正确安装证书,然后重启web服务器和浏览器以解决问题。

在总结中,当您遇到Lua SSL证书验证错误时,可以按照上述步骤进行解决。您需要检查证书的过期日期,确认证书颁发机构是否有效,确保证书与主机名匹配并验证证书是否正确安装。在保护您的应

用程序和用户的安全性方面,SSL证书验证是至关重要的,因此,解决此问题可以保护您的应用程序免受各种威胁。

本文标签: 证书验证颁发机构错误